World Osteoporosis Day: 20 October

The World Osteoporosis Day (WOD) is observed annually on October 20. The day aims to raise global awareness of the prevention, diagnosis and treatment of osteoporosis and metabolic bone disease. WOD is organized by the International Osteoporosis Foundation (IOF), by launch of a year-long campaign with a specific theme. In 2021 the Global WOD Campaign theme is “Serve Up Bone Strength”.

What is osteoporosis?

Osteoporosis causes bones to become weak and fragile so that they break easily – even as a result of a minor fall, a bump, a sneeze, or a sudden movement. Fractures caused by osteoporosis can be life-threatening and a major cause of pain and long-term disability. Osteoporosis is a growing global problem worldwide. It affects one in three women and one in five men over the age of 50.

Important takeaways for all competitive exams:

  • International Osteoporosis Foundation Headquarters location: Nyon, Switzerland;
  • International Osteoporosis Foundation President: Cyrus Cooper;
  • International Osteoporosis Foundation Founded: 1998.
